What is SEO and Why is it Important?

What is Search Engine Optimization, more commonly called SEO? It’s the practice of making changes to websites so that they are more visible in search engine results. Search engines have their own unique algorithms to generate search results. These algorithms look at various ranking factors to decide how to rank search pages. Ranking higher on search results means that it’s more likely that potential clients will see your website and engage with your business.

Off-Page Optimization

Off-page optimization refers to activities outside the boundaries of a website. It primarily deals with link building for the purpose of building a website’s trust and credibility. To rank, search engines attempt to accumulate these external signals to create a clear picture of a website’s authority and credibility. There are three strategies for off-page optimization: acquire backlinks, social media marketing, and manage your online reputation. A huge portion of off-page optimization is all about link building, and it entails building relationships with bloggers and deciding to share high-value information you have on your site. It’s important to create trust with websites for publishing great articles on your site and trustworthiness for publishing great articles on someone else’s site. Of course, they should be relevant, and that is where on-page factors come in. Technical SEO

Technical SEO forms the backbone of your website. It encompasses everything that makes your website infrastructure better, faster, and easier for search engines to crawl and index. Some of the important technical SEO issues you need to know include:

• Site speed: Site loading speed is important for two reasons. Search engines consider it as one of the ranking factors, and visitors expect websites to load fast, too. Delays in the page load time are likely to increase the bounce rate and the abandonment rate. Image optimization, minification of CSS, JavaScript, and HTML, and reduction of redirects could help speed up your site.

• Mobile responsiveness: Google rolled out mobile-first indexing in March 2021. It means Google typically uses the mobile version of a website for indexing and ranking, instead of the desktop version. It’s crucial for your website to be mobile-friendly. A responsive website makes it easier for search engines to understand and serve the content. Responsive websites offer a better mobile user experience, which can improve website performance.

• URL structure: URL stands for “Uniform Resource Locator.” They are the addresses for individual web pages. A well-defined URL structure organizes the website’s content, engages the visitors, and spreads the website value to the foundational pages utilizing clear logical paths. A clear URL structure improves SEO because it ensures that the website’s content can be easily indexed and understood by search engines. It is also important for creating an engaging user experience.

• HTTPS and SSL: HTTPS, which is short for Hypertext Transfer Protocol Secure, is a secure version of HTTP. The ‘S’ at the end of HTTPS stands for ‘Secure’. It means all communications between your browser and the website are encrypted. If not, it could be prone to cyber-attacks and give rise to a lower ranking. Not having SSL, search engines mark the websites as unsafe. As a result, visitors are likely to feel insecure and will likely leave right away. If an internet browser blocks your website visit due to an HTTP connection rather than a secure HTTPS connection, it could directly affect your website visits. You will lose a major share of online users and foot traffic if you have neglected implementing SSL. No matter how well-designed your website is, your visitors won’t trust it if they see warnings about security and privacy.

• User experience: It’s about making sure that your readers or visitors spend more time on your website. Your site navigation is supported by clean code. When a search engine understands how a website is strong, your site will get a ranking boost. When a user has a good online experience, they will be more likely to stay longer, decreasing the bounce rate. A lower bounce rate tells search engines that your site is useful, relevant, and high-quality. In this way, a clean and simple navigation system favors SEO in the long run. Technical issues are harmful not only for the likely traffic but also for the search rankings. A cluttered site or links that don’t lead anywhere can cause the search engine to leave before finishing the crawl, and that ensures that the search engine may not index the page at all or may reindex the page only after the changes have been made, resulting in a loss of rankings. Regularly checking these movements and trying to patch broken or bad linkages can guarantee minimal damage to rankings and sales in the future.

Performance Metrics and Reporting

One of the most crucial parts of an SEO retainer is how your agency’s performance will be evaluated. Tracking and measuring success help you understand whether the agency’s approach is working. These key performance indicators (KPIs) may include metrics such as organic traffic growth, keyword rankings, SERP visibility, and conversion rate changes. Some of the initial focus may be to lift your website toward the top of the SERPs simply with better targeting, better on-page optimization, improved site speed, and mobile performance. This should start to increase organic traffic. From there, PPC costs should eventually fall as traffic from organic rankings increases. Higher CTRs for higher organic positions on page one will also significantly improve form inquiries, email inquiries, and telephone calls.

You should know how they are presently ranking for their targeted search phrases. You can’t know who to target with conversion marketing unless you know which phrases are attracting your best traffic. There are a number of tools available to help track keyword rankings.
